随着Web3技术的飞速发展和数字资产的普及,越来越多的Web3平台涌现出来,为用户提供去中心化的服务,欧一Web3平台(此处“欧一”可能指代特定平台,或泛指欧洲/国际某Web3平台,具体请以实际平台名为准)作为其中的一个新兴力量,其业务往来中难免会涉及到稳定币U(通常指USDT,Tether)的收付,对于平台运营者或开发者而言,了解如何在合规、安全的前提下收取U币,是保障业务顺利开展的关键,本文将详细探讨欧一Web3平台收取U币的常见方式、操作流程及相关注意事项。
了解U币(USDT)及其在Web3平台的应用
在深入探讨收款方式前,我们首先需要明确U币通常指的是USDT,这是一种与美元1:1锚定的稳定币,基于多种区块链发行(如以太坊ERC-20、波场TRC-20、Solana等),其价值相对稳定,被广泛用于Web3生态内的交易、支付、结算等场景,因其规避了加密货币价格剧烈波动的风险,成为连接法币与加密世界的重要桥梁。
欧一Web3平台收取U币,通常是为了服务费、产品购买、佣金、充值等多种商业目的。
欧一Web3平台收取U币的主要方式
Web3平台收取U币的方式多种多样,具体选择取决于平台的业务模式、技术架构、目标用户群体以及合规要求,以下是一些常见的方式:
-
平台钱包地址收款:
- 描述: 这是最直接的方式,平台在支持的区块链(如以太坊、波场、币安智能链等)上创建一个或多多个官方钱包地址,用户将U币(对应链上的USDT,如ERC-20 USDT、TRC-20 USDT)直接转账到该指定地址。
- 流程:
- 平台生成并安全存储各链种的收款钱包地址(通常为冷钱包或热钱包)。
- 在用户界面(UI/UX)清晰展示对应链种的U币收款地址,并标注支持的链种(“请向以下以太坊地址充值ERC-20 USDT”)。
- 用户复制地址,通过自己的加密货币钱包(如MetaMask、Trust Wallet等)进行转账。
- 平台通过区块链浏览器或节点服务监控收款地址的交易状态,确认到账后,为用户账户余额进行增记。
- 优点: 操作简单,用户自主性强,无需第三方中介。
- 缺点: 需要平台自行管理钱包私钥,安全性要求高;手动处理可能效率较低,需配合自动化监控。
-
集成第三方支付/聚合服务商:
- 描述: 平台可以集成专注于加密货币支付的第三方服务商(如Stripe Crypto、MoonPay、PayPal Crypto(部分地区)、或一些专门的加密支付网关),这些服务商提供API接口,支持用户通过多种方式(包括信用卡、银行转账、加密钱包等)购买U币并支付给平台。
- 流程:
- 平台选择合适的第三方支付服务商并完成集成对接。
- 用户在平台选择支付U币的选项,会被引导至第三方支付网关。
- 用户在第三方网关完成U币的购买或支付(可能涉及法币充值或直接转账U币)。
- 第三方服务商确认支付成功后,通过API通知平台,平台相应地为用户充值U币。
- 优点: 用户体验好,支持多种支付方式,可简化平台的合规和技术负担(如KYC/AML)。
- 缺点: 需要向第三方支付服务商支付一定比例的手续费;依赖第三方服务的稳定性和合规性。
-
基于智能合约的自动收款:
- 描述: 对于一些去中心化程度更高或需要自动化执行的场景(如NFT销售、DeFi产品收益分配),平台可以部署智能合约来收取U币,用户直接与智能合约交互,将U币转入合约地址,合约根据预设逻辑自动执行后续操作(如解锁服务、分配权益等)。
- 流程:
- 平台开发者编写并部署接收U币的智能合约(一个简单的支付合约,或更复杂的NFT售卖合约)。
- 在平台界面展示智能合约的地址或嵌入交互界面(如DApp浏览器)。
- 用户调用智能合约,发送U币到合约地址。
- 智能合约自动验证交易,并触发预设的后续逻辑。
- 优点: 高度自动化、去中心化、透明可追溯,无需人工干预。
- 缺点: 智能合约开发、审计和部署成本较高,存在代码漏洞风险;用户体验可能不如中心化应用友好。
-
交易所/OTC通道收款:
- 描述: 如果平台的主要用户群体是通过交易所进行U币交易的,可以考虑与交易所合作或引导用户通过交易所的充值/转账功能,对于大额或特定场景,也可能通过OTC(场外交易)商家进行U币的收购和收款。
- 流程:
- 平台与交易所达成合作,或为用户提供指定交易所的充值指引。
- 用户在交易所购买U币后,将U币从交易所提现到平台提供的官方钱包地址。
- (对于OTC)平台与OTC商家对接,用户通过OTC商家将法币转换为U币并支付给平台。
- 优点: 依托交易所的流动性,方便用户获取U币。
- 缺点: 交易所提现可能产生额外费用和到账时间;OTC方式涉及额外的合规风险和操作复杂性。
欧一Web3平台收取U币的注意事项
无论选择哪种方式,欧一Web3平台在收取U币时都需高度重视以下几点:
-
合规性(KYC/AML):
